$1000 deductible..you will find alot of policies with a minumun of 2% wind (Hurricane) damage and that would be anywhere from $4000-5000 deductible. I have seen Sinkhole coverage with 10% deductibles..and in the furture that may become more of the standard.....and these deductibles do not necessarily bring lower (expected) costs!

WE all should have Sinkhole coverage and hopefully never use it so the high deductible would not impact us BUT we all need wind or Hurricane coverage......that one is only a matter of time.
